    Embracing the Outdoors in September

    Explore Connecticut’s State Parks

    Immerse yourself in nature by exploring Connecticut’s stunning State Parks during September. With the weather still warm and pleasant, it’s the perfect time to venture outdoors for a day of hiking, picnicking, or simply enjoying the picturesque surroundings. Consider visiting parks like Sleeping Giant State Park with its diverse trails offering breathtaking views of the region. Spend a day at Hammonasset Beach State Park, where you can relax on the beach, go birdwatching, or take a leisurely walk along the coast. These State Parks offer a serene escape from the hustle and bustle of daily life.

    Attend an Outdoor Fall Festival

    September in Connecticut is abuzz with vibrant outdoor fall festivals that celebrate the season in all its glory. Head to the Wethersfield Cornfest for a taste of local cuisine and live music in a charming outdoor setting. Visit the Guilford Fair for traditional agricultural displays, carnival rides, and agricultural exhibits that showcase Connecticut’s rich farming heritage. These festivals are perfect for enjoying the crisp fall air, indulging in seasonal treats, and engaging in fun activities for the whole family.

    Experience the Thrill at Adventure Parks

    For an adrenaline-packed day out, visit one of Connecticut’s adventure parks and experience thrilling activities that will get your heart racing. Take on zip lines, aerial obstacle courses, or climbing walls at parks like The Adventure Park at Storrs for an exciting outdoor adventure. Challenge yourself with treetop ropes courses or zip line tours at Brownstone Exploration & Discovery Park for a day filled with excitement and adventure. These parks offer a unique way to embrace the outdoors in September and create unforgettable memories with friends and family.

    Visit Local Farmers’ Markets

    Exploring the vibrant local farmers’ markets in Connecticut is a wonderful way to experience the bounty of the harvest season. You’ll find an array of fresh produce, artisanal goods, and local delicacies that showcase the region’s agricultural richness. Head to markets like the Coventry Farmers’ Market or the Hartford Farmers’ Market to sample seasonal treats, interact with local farmers, and support the community’s agricultural endeavors. It’s a perfect opportunity to savor the flavors of fall and connect with the heart of Connecticut’s agricultural landscape.

    Enjoy Apple Picking at Orchards

    Venture out to charming apple orchards scattered across Connecticut for a quintessential autumn experience. Engage in the age-old tradition of apple picking amidst picturesque surroundings, breathing in the crisp, fresh air of the season. Places like Lyman Orchards in Middlefield or Beardsley’s Cider Mill & Orchard in Shelton offer a delightful escape into the orchards, where you can handpick your favorite apples straight from the trees. Whether you’re seeking the perfect ingredients for apple pie or simply relishing the joy of harvesting your own fruits, apple picking in Connecticut’s orchards is a rejuvenating and memorable activity for all.

    Sample the Wine During Harvest Time

    Connecticut’s wineries come alive during the harvest season, offering visitors the opportunity to witness the winemaking process in action. Plan a visit to local vineyards such as Gouveia Vineyards in Wallingford or Sunset Meadow Vineyards in Goshen to partake in wine tastings amidst the autumnal beauty of the vineyards. From robust reds to crisp whites, you can sample an array of wines crafted from locally grown grapes, all while enjoying the scenic views and serene ambiance of the wineries. It’s a fantastic way to appreciate the artistry of winemaking and savor the unique flavors of Connecticut’s vineyards during the harvest season.

    Water-Based Adventures

    Go for a Kayak or Canoe Ride

    Paddle through Connecticut’s serene waterways as you immerse yourself in the beauty of September. Grab a kayak or canoe and explore the state’s tranquil rivers or picturesque lakes. Navigate through lush foliage, vibrant colors, and maybe even catch a glimpse of some local wildlife. It’s a perfect way to enjoy the crisp autumn air and connect with nature.

    When embarking on your kayak or canoe adventure, remember to pack essentials like sunscreen, water, and snacks. Opt for comfortable clothing suitable for the weather, and don’t forget your camera to capture the stunning surroundings.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ced paddler, these water-based excursions are sure to provide a memorable experience for you this September.

    Fishing Experiences in Connecticut’s Rivers

    Cast your line into Connecticut’s rivers for a relaxing and fulfilling fishing experience this September. Whether you’re a seasoned angler or a novice looking to try your hand at fishing, the state offers a variety of fishing spots teeming with different fish species. Enjoy the tranquility of the flowing waters as you wait for the perfect catch.

    Before heading out to fish, ensure you have the necessary permits and licenses as per Connecticut’s regulations. Pack your fishing gear, including rods, baits, and tackle, and consider the type of fish you want to target. Research the best fishing locations in the state to increase your chances of a successful outing. Whether you prefer fly fishing, baitcasting, or spin casting, Connecticut’s rivers provide an idyllic setting for a peaceful day of fishing in the crisp September weather.
